The OtterFlash service publishes firmware images to devices subscribed to a named channel (stable, beta, or canary). Support staff editing an environment should confirm CHANNEL_NAME matches the device cohort exactly; mismatches cause silent update skips, not errors. ROLLOUT_PERCENT controls staged delivery and should stay below 25 for new images. Images are pulled from the Brindlewood artifact store, and each pull request must be signed. The signing credential belongs in the env file immediately after this sentence:

secret setting of yajog-taguf: ARCHIVE_KEY3=051

Handover — bike cage & parking

Bike cage is behind Block C, Wrenfield site. Gates open 06:30, lock at 20:00 sharp — don't get caught out. Parking gates run off the same keypad; contractors use bays 14–19 only. Report faults to facilities, not reception. Keypad code for both gates is below.

staff pass of kawip-hawef = bdg-QLP-2

Quick excerpt for Thursday's sync: the public Lanternfish API currently paginates with raw offsets, which falls over past page 400 on the orders index. Proposal is cursor-based tokens signed by the Driftgate layer, with caps so nobody requests a million rows and melts the replica. Caps are centralized in one constants table, reproduced below for discussion.

tuning table, yajog-yahof:
BUDGETS = {
    "lamvan": 303,
    "wenox": 460,
    "fenvan": 525,
}